Overview and Gameplay

Five separate stories build toward one final campaign in Dragon Warrior IV. Ragnar investigates missing children, Princess Alena escapes royal life, Taloon works toward owning a shop, Mara and Nara seek justice, and the chosen Hero eventually unites them. Exploration spans towns, castles, caves, towers, and a changing day-and-night world, with random encounters leading to first-person turn-based battles. Experience, spells, equipment, gold, vehicles, and party recruitment drive progression across five chapters.

In Chapter 5, the player controls the Hero while companions follow selected tactics. A wagon carries reserves, allows party swaps in battle, and shares experience with riders.

Version Notes

This North American localization uses the title Dragon Warrior IV and NES-era names such as Taloon, Mara, Nara, Cristo, and Brey. It contains five chapters and retains the original companion AI rather than the later remakes’ full-party command option.

Release And Credits

  • NES release: October 1992
  • Developer: Chunsoft
  • Publisher: Enix America Corporation
  • Game design: Yuji Horii
  • Monster design: Akira Toriyama
  • Music: Koichi Sugiyama
